About

The mission of the florida sheriffs association as a self-sustaining, charitable organization, is to foster the effectiveness of the office of sheriff through leadership, innovative practices, legislative initiatives, education and training.

501(h) election

This 501(c)(3) elected the 501(h) safe-harbor — lobbying expenditures are capped under a clear dollar formula instead of the "insubstantial part" standard.
